DEFINITION

Classification: 327/387

Control signal derived from or responsive to input signal:

(under subclass 379) Subject matter wherein the control signal is dependent on or generated from a characteristic of the input signal.

(1) Note. For example, in FET switching devices, a control signal which is responsive to the constancy or fluctuations of an input signal would be fed to the gate electrode to control the FET channel impedance.
